Oceans are typically categorized into five major bodies of water: the Pacific, Atlantic, Indian, Southern (or Antarctic), and Arctic Oceans. These categories are based on geographical boundaries and distinct characteristics, such as size, depth, and temperature. Additionally, oceans can be further divided into regions like coastal, open ocean (pelagic), and deep sea zones, which reflect varying ecological environments and marine life.

Neritic zones are closer to shore, shallower, and warmer than open ocean zones. They also tend to have higher levels of nutrients and more sunlight penetration, supporting greater biodiversity and productivity compared to open ocean zones.

There are two major ocean zones, Pelagic and Benthic zones. The Pelagic zone is the open ocean and the Benthic zone is the ocean bottom.
